Laila Lalami was nominated by Abdourahman Waberi for the programme section “Literatures of the World”. Inspired by newspaper reports of Moroccan refugees, she published her prize-winning novel “Hope and Other Dangerous Pursuits” in 2005, a work that follows the lives of four migrants after landfall in Spain. In her new novel “Secret Son” – which Lalami will be presenting in Berlin, and which will be published in early 2009 – the author returns to Morocco: in the centre of the story is Youssef, who is growing up in the slums of Casablanca.

In "Portrait with Keys" Ivan Vladislavić paints a vivid and complex portrait of Johannesburg and the new South Africa. Empathically he ambles through his city as observer, collector and participant at the same time. With finely tuned precision and humour he describes the fears, the prejudices and hopes of the inhabitants, creating – in 138 chapters – his personal topography of Johannesburg.
